Maison > base de données > tutoriel mysql > Comment puis-je déterminer le nombre de colonnes dans une table de base de données à l'aide de SQL ?

Comment puis-je déterminer le nombre de colonnes dans une table de base de données à l'aide de SQL ?

DDD
Libérer: 2025-01-24 19:22:08
original
443 Les gens l'ont consulté

How Can I Determine the Number of Columns in a Database Table using SQL?

Compter efficacement les colonnes d'une table de base de données à l'aide de SQL

Connaître le nombre de colonnes dans une table de base de données est essentiel pour de nombreuses tâches de programmation. Ce guide montre une requête SQL concise pour y parvenir.

Requête SQL pour le nombre de colonnes :

La requête suivante exploite la table système INFORMATION_SCHEMA.COLUMNS pour récupérer le nombre de colonnes :

<code class="language-sql">SELECT COUNT(*)
FROM INFORMATION_SCHEMA.COLUMNS
WHERE table_catalog = 'your_database_name'
  AND table_name = 'your_table_name';</code>
Copier après la connexion

Remplacez your_database_name et your_table_name par vos noms de base de données et de table actuels. Cette requête filtre la table INFORMATION_SCHEMA.COLUMNS, qui stocke les métadonnées sur toutes les colonnes de la base de données, pour renvoyer uniquement le nombre de colonnes pour la table spécifiée. Le résultat est une valeur unique représentant le nombre total de colonnes.

Ce nombre de colonnes est inestimable pour des tâches telles que la validation des données, l'analyse du schéma de base de données et la génération de code dynamique.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al